Experts Predict Transformative Changes in the Europe Heat Pump Industry by 2035

The Europe Heat Pump Industry is on the brink of significant transformation, with an anticipated market size reaching USD 63.5 billion by 2035. This forecast underscores the increasing demand for energy-efficient heating solutions driven by rising energy prices and growing environmental concerns. The sector is projected to experience a robust compound annual growth rate (CAGR) of 10.10%. This growth trajectory illustrates not only the urgency of addressing climate change but also highlights the strategic pivots that companies must undertake to stay competitive in this evolving landscape. The drive towards renewable energy sources is further bolstered by governmental policies advocating for energy efficiency across the continent.

Key industry participants such as Daikin (JP), Mitsubishi Electric (JP), Carrier (US), Trane Technologies (IE), Bosch (DE), LG Electronics (KR), Fujitsu (JP), Hitachi (JP), and NIBE (SE) are pivotal in directing market advancements. These stakeholders are engaged in continuous innovation, developing smarter and more sustainable heat pump solutions that cater to the growing consumer demand for efficiency. The competitive landscape is rapidly changing, with increased collaboration between manufacturers and technology providers to integrate advanced features into heat pumps. Recent developments in Germany, which leads the market, reflect a societal commitment to renewable energy, positioning itself as a model for other European nations.

Several dynamics are fueling the growth of the Europe Heat Pump Industry. Regulatory frameworks encouraging energy efficiency are fundamental; governments are increasingly establishing targets aimed at reducing carbon footprints, which support the deployment of heat pumps. Furthermore, the uptick in energy costs is prompting consumers to seek alternative heating solutions that provide long-term savings. In addition, technological advancements are enabling the integration of smart technologies into heat pumps, allowing for enhanced efficiency and user experience. For instance, the incorporation of IoT capabilities facilitates real-time monitoring and control, aligning with the modern consumer's need for convenience and efficiency. Nevertheless, challenges persist, notably the high initial costs associated with heat pump installations, which may hinder widespread adoption despite the long-term financial benefits.

In regional terms, Germany stands out as the largest market for heat pumps, thanks to its strong infrastructure supporting renewable technologies. The nation's commitment to sustainability is mirrored in its robust policies and incentives aimed at promoting heat pump installations. Conversely, the UK is rapidly becoming the fastest-growing region, attributed to increasing awareness among consumers about energy-efficient heating solutions. France and the Nordic countries are also emerging markets, each with specific regulatory frameworks that encourage the adoption of heat pumps. These regions possess unique characteristics that differentiate their market dynamics while collectively contributing to the industry's growth.

According to a recent report, over 40% of European households are projected to adopt heat pumps by 2030, reflecting a significant shift towards sustainable heating solutions. This adoption rate is largely driven by the EU's Green Deal, which aims to cut greenhouse gas emissions by at least 55% by 2030. In Germany, the government has set a target to install 1.5 million heat pumps annually by 2024, a move that has already led to a 25% increase in installations from the previous year. As the market matures, we can expect to see a ripple effect; as more consumers adopt heat pumps, economies of scale will reduce costs, making them more accessible to a broader audience. This cycle not only enhances energy security but also supports local economies through job creation in the green technology sector. AI Impact Analysis

AI and machine learning are set to transform the Europe Heat Pump Industry by optimizing operational efficiencies and enhancing user engagement. Predictive analytics can facilitate proactive maintenance, significantly reducing operational disruptions and maintenance costs. Furthermore, AI can enable adaptive systems that respond to changing environmental conditions, maximizing energy efficiency. For example, smart heat pumps can adjust their operations based on real-time data, ensuring optimal performance while minimizing energy consumption.
